November 2025 monthly summary for SkriptLang/Skript. Focused on extending entity aging logic by adding a new 'child' age state to the EffMakeAdultOrBaby effect, enabling more nuanced control over living entities in gameplay scripts. The change is captured by commit 3ca1789ab7ce6022782bbbb43b178bd037ee5023 with the message 'Added "child" to patterns of EffMakeAdultOrBaby (#8286)'.
